Regular Season Round 11: Nes-Ziona - Bnei Hertzeliya 81-79
Date: December 26, 2018
The most exciting game of round 11 in the Winner League took place in Nes Ziyona. This derby game ended with only two-point defeat on the road of 7th ranked Bnei Hasharon (4-7) to eighth ranked Ironi Nes-Ziona (5-6) 81-79 on Wednesday evening. The hosts trailed by 3 points at the halftime before their 27-18 charge in the third quarter, which allowed them to win the game. The best player for the winners was American-Puerto Rican guard Gary Browne (185-93, college: W.Virginia) who scored 18 points and 9 rebounds. Naturalized Welsh Tal-Michael Dunne (198-87) chipped in 14 points, 5 rebounds and 6 assists. American forward Jeff Adrien (201-86, college: Connecticut) produced a double-double by scoring 13 points, 10 rebounds and 5 assists and American-Georgian guard Michael Dixon (186-90, college: Memphis, agency: Interperformances) added 20 points (was perfect 7-for-7 from the free throw line) respectively for the guests.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Ironi Nes-Ziona have a solid series of three victories in a row. They moved-up to sixth place, which they share with Beer Sheva. Bnei Hasharon at the other side dropped to the eighth position with seven games lost. They share it with Rishon. Ironi Nes-Ziona is looking forward to face Rishon (#9) in Rishon Le-Zion in the next round. Bnei Hasharon will play on the road against Hapoel Jerusalem and is hoping to win this game.
Top scorers:
Bnei Hertzeliya: M.Dixon 20+2reb+2ast, B.Bliznyuk 13+3reb+1ast, J.Adrien 13+10reb+5ast, G.Levin 11+3reb+1ast, O.Leumi 8+1reb, S.Singer 6+1reb+3ast
Nes-Ziona: D.Cook 19+4reb+1ast, G.Browne 18+9reb+1ast, T.Michael Dunne 14+5reb+6ast, G.Lee 12+8reb, G.Gutt 8+4reb+6ast, R.Pitshon 4+2reb
